Grand Theft Auto Games Ranked By Difficulty
4. Grand Theft Auto 5
The most recent entry in the franchise, despite being over a decade old, is still Grand Theft Auto 5. Focusing on three different characters that work together on a series of jobs in Los Santos, this entry had an expansive scope and brought a lot of new and updated features to the series, making a lot of driving and shooting controls which the series has struggled with a huge amount less challenging.
Between the scale of Grand Theft Auto 5 and the popularity of the online mode, giving fans the chance to enter roleplaying servers and join their friends in the world of Los Santos, the popularity of this game still hasn't waned. But the difficulty has never been considered high by players. Compared to the entries that preceded it, GTA 5 is a generally easy game that doesn't punish mistakes nearly as much as older titles.
3. Grand Theft Auto: Vice City
Vice City is an oft-overlooked Grand Theft Auto game that deserves more recognition than it gets for having some of the best narrative moments in any GTA game, and one of the best open-worlds of its time. However, this was another game that came in the days of the franchise when Rockstar was still trying to perfect the art of the 3D open world, and as such, there were a few interesting difficulty problems.
While the auto-aim was a problem in some GTA games, Vice City wouldn’t let players use the feature in certain missions where there was a lot of combat, and the difficulties in aiming for themselves left many players feeling particularly frustrated with combat in the game. It was also difficult to find and stay in good cover while getting into shoot-outs, further adding to the hardship that players faced in combat all the way through the game. While Vice City is a great entry that deserves to be remembered narratively, there are a few things about it that continue irritating players to this day when they revisit the entry.
2. Grand Theft Auto 3
Grand Theft Auto 3 was the very first game in the franchise to feature a 3D open-world style, making it the first game in the franchise that fans remember well and consider to be legendary, and one of the most experimental Rockstar titles ever. It won many Game of the Year awards and is considered by many to be one of the best games of all time. However, Rockstar made many changes to this entry and as such, there was a surprising level of difficulty to Grand Theft Auto 3.

Controls were somewhat less smooth than they would be in later entries, and players had a hard time as a result. There were also just a lot of random enemy spawns, and the AI was generally a little better at taking players out if challenged than they would be in later games in the series. While GTA 3 remains a beautifully fun, legendary game that always deserves a replay, there are some problems with the difficulty that still irritate some gamers to this day.
1.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as
San Andreas, despite being one of the most beloved video games in history, is the hardest of the lot when it comes to the GTA franchise. The controls hadn’t entirely been fixed from previous entries but much of the general frustration that players had over the lack of swimming mechanics and other challenges that led to silly deaths had been fixed, improving the game and making the difficulty much more on-purpose.
Instead, San Andreas simply created some of the most difficult missions in the history of the franchise. From the "Wrong Side of the Tracks" mission onwards, players begin to see how ridiculously hard it can be to complete some of the missions in San Andreas. However, with changes to the controls in the Remastered Trilogy that was recently released, some of the difficulty in older entries has been neutralized and made a lot more accessible for gamers who want to experience the more fun aspects of these games without all the original challenges, including one of the most brutal final missions in the franchise.
